Abstrak
Industrial IoT devices play a critical role in modern manufacturing but often lack adequate security against tampering and runtime attacks. This paper proposes the use of Trusted Remote Attestation (TRA) as a lightweight and scalable method to verify the integrity of Industrial Internet of Things (IIoT) devices. By enabling remote validation of device state without requiring extensive hardware changes, TRA enhances trust and aligns with Zero Trust security principles. A practical implementation is discussed, demonstrating TRA's effectiveness in improving cybersecurity assurance for industrial environments. © 2025 IEEE.
